Position Summary:

This position reports to the Senior Director, Access Strategy and Provider Accounts, Transplant and is responsible for serving as the medical policy, therapeutic disease state, and product expert for their defined geography. They will be responsible for establishing and leveraging credible relationships which may include, but not limited to, integrated delivery networks, health systems, and kidney transplant centers to increase the kidney transplant patient population relevant to dialysis.  

This individual will be responsible for engaging in frequent and compliant discussions with key decision makers, to promote the clinical and economic value of kidney transplantation and Thymoglobulin, and, if appropriate, impact change of existing policies to align with internal strategies for assigned products. This individual will assess sales implications of short- and long- term actions with each customer and take action to move payer, IDN and transplant center decisions in a direction that continues to open patient access to care with Sanofi products. 

The National Business Director will demonstrate strong relationships with Health System C-suite, Medical Benefit Directors and Managers, Transplant Center Administrators, Transplant Surgical and Medical Directors, as well as other population-based decision makers. Efforts will include executing pull-through strategies to the regional health plans of the national organizations, as well as initiatives with other large and regional managed care organizations. In addition, this role is the primary lead for targeted IDN strategies and a collaborative partner with the Key Account Managers in providing EHR clinical decision alert education, kidney transplant procedure MS-DRG reimbursement and RWE discussions with transplant center population-based decision makers.    

This individual will work collaboratively with Sanofi matrix partners including market access, medical, marketing, regional and national account directors, government public policy, patient advocacy, and sales leadership teams to ensure consistent exchange of stakeholder insights and messaging.  

The National Business Director will deliver regular market updates to sales management and internal teams on key payer trends and healthcare reform developments.

Main Responsibilities:

  • Partner with national and regional account teams to implement strategies and tactics with select payers to support the growth of the kidney transplant patient population.

  • Lead Sanofi’s work with IDNs and Health Systems, implement targeted strategies and tactics tailored to this customer base to educate and promote the clinical and economic value of kidney transplantation.

  • Collaborate with key account managers to support transplant centers on MS-DRG reimbursement and RWE initiatives for kidney transplant procedures, while advocating for the economic value of transplantation to population health decision-makers.

  • Promote medical policy coverage enabling increased access to kidney transplantation and to our products.

  • Maintain rigorous data integrity through timely documentation of customer interactions in CRM systems and accurate updating of internal reporting tools.

  • Maintain responsibility for positive business outcomes within overlapping accounts.

  • Provide timely insights to the access strategy brand team on key payer trends, reimbursement, government legislation and CMS payment models affecting CKD, dialysis, kidney transplantation and product utilization.

  • Represent the Access Strategy organization, with professionalism and integrity, at professional society meetings, national payer organizations meetings and internally with various departmental and leadership teams.
